Story Role

Ginchiyo begins as a highly successful Izanagi trooper studying the organization's mononoke-elimination rankings and worrying that even strong samurai cannot cover every threatened area. When she learns that unexplained mononoke defeats have been occurring outside ordinary Izanagi operations, she investigates Dora and Kusanagi.

Her first encounter with them is deliberately confrontational. Ginchiyo attacks Kusanagi and tests whether the pair will use lethal force against a human samurai. Kusanagi refuses to fight her directly, while Dora insists that samurai themselves are not their enemy.

Satisfied that the partnership is ethical, Ginchiyo reveals that the confrontation was partly a test. She offers Dora and Kusanagi work as her collaborators, arguing that their unusual strength can help her prevent deaths in areas the overstretched Izanagi Force cannot cover. She even pays Dora's landlord after the fight damages his home.

Ginchiyo becomes their first meaningful bridge into the official anti-mononoke organization. She continues working with them as stronger creatures appear and remains willing to argue that Kusanagi should be judged by behavior rather than species.

Her deeper reason for pursuing promotion is eventually revealed to involve Yujin Yagyu. As a child, Ginchiyo watched Yujin overwork himself because his strength made everyone depend on him. When he refused to quit voluntarily, she resolved to rise high enough within the Izanagi Force that she could eventually remove him from duty herself and give him the quiet life he once said he wanted.

Ginchiyo later trains directly under Yujin and develops her speed-based swordsmanship further. Her growth turns the initially career-obsessed young trooper into one of the principal fighters confronting the increasingly dangerous mononoke threatening the Izanagi Force.
